Philly, you basically had it right the first time ... we will have Joey for two years because his third year calls for him to make 15+ million! No friggin way are we paying that shit!

<quote from the link you posted>
The third year of the deal is designed to be so prohibitive that it will force the Dolphins to restructure the contract or release the veteran quarterback. It includes a $10 million roster bonus, a $5 million base salary and an exorbitant cap charge of $15.733 million.
